Review of Shaw & Co. A Shining Light in City Lane. I entered the door and was immediately greeted with a smile from the waitress as I considered the choice of tables. The gentle beat of music being enjoyed by patrons in a warm rustic timber environment contrasted the cool breeze of a table in the lane. I chose the table outside where the breeze was refreshing (and much quieter). A Shiraz awoke the palate with its dry oaky feel and dazzled with its expression of fine taste. I considered the wide choice of bovine delights that were dispersed through the menu and I chose Porterhouse steak with vegetables and mushroom sauce over the rump, rib and sirloin that also tempted me from the page. The vegetables were served with a dash of garlic butter which, as the meal continued, melted through and drenched their perfectly cooked crunchiness with the mouth watering smell and taste that only garlic can deliver. The small cob of corn in particular delivered a crisp texture that strongly suggested that the cornfield where it grew and its yellow form had only recently parted. And the steak? Ah the steak! Ordered medium rare (of course!) the juicy tenderness of the porterhouse was evident from the moment it met the serrated edge of my steak knife. The generous serving of mushroom sauce complemented the prime cut of beef as it disappeared quickly from my plate, leaving only the memory and the flavour in my mouth which disappointingly passed with time.
